340 }
341
342 /**
343  * Helper to destroy a locked lock.
344  *
345  * Used by ldlm_lock_destroy and ldlm_lock_destroy_nolock
346  * Must be called with l_lock and lr_lock held.
347  *
348  * Does not actually free the lock data, but rather marks the lock as
349  * destroyed by setting l_destroyed field in the lock to 1.  Destroys a
350  * handle->lock association too, so that the lock can no longer be found
351  * and removes the lock from LRU list.  Actual lock freeing occurs when
352  * last lock reference goes away.
353  *
354  * Original comment (of some historical value):
355  * This used to have a 'strict' flag, which recovery would use to mark an
356  * in-use lock as needing-to-die.  Lest I am ever tempted to put it back, I
357  * shall explain why it's gone: with the new hash table scheme, once you call
358  * ldlm_lock_destroy, you can never drop your final references on this lock.
359  * Because it's not in the hash table anymore.  -phil
360  */
361 int ldlm_lock_destroy_internal(struct ldlm_lock *lock)
362 {
363         ENTRY;
364
365         if (lock->l_readers || lock->l_writers) {
366                 LDLM_ERROR(lock, "lock still has references");
367                 LBUG();
368         }
369
370         if (!cfs_list_empty(&lock->l_res_link)) {
371                 LDLM_ERROR(lock, "lock still on resource");
372                 LBUG();
373         }
374
375         if (ldlm_is_destroyed(lock)) {
376                 LASSERT(cfs_list_empty(&lock->l_lru));
377                 EXIT;
378                 return 0;
379         }
380         ldlm_set_destroyed(lock);
381
382         if (lock->l_export && lock->l_export->exp_lock_hash) {
383                 /* NB: it's safe to call cfs_hash_del() even lock isn't
384                  * in exp_lock_hash. */
385                 /* In the function below, .hs_keycmp resolves to
386                  * ldlm_export_lock_keycmp() */
387                 /* coverity[overrun-buffer-val] */
388                 cfs_hash_del(lock->l_export->exp_lock_hash,
389                              &lock->l_remote_handle, &lock->l_exp_hash);
390         }
391
392         ldlm_lock_remove_from_lru(lock);
393         class_handle_unhash(&lock->l_handle);
394
395 #if 0
396         /* Wake anyone waiting for this lock */
397         /* FIXME: I should probably add yet another flag, instead of using
398          * l_export to only call this on clients */
399         if (lock->l_export)
400                 class_export_put(lock->l_export);
401         lock->l_export = NULL;
402         if (lock->l_export && lock->l_completion_ast)
403                 lock->l_completion_ast(lock, 0);
404 #endif
405         EXIT;
406         return 1;
407 }

1305 EXPORT_SYMBOL(ldlm_lock_allow_match);
1306
1307 /**
1308  * Attempt to find a lock with specified properties.
1309  *
1310  * Typically returns a reference to matched lock unless L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K is
1311  * set in \a flags
1312  *
1313  * Can be called in two ways:
1314  *
1315  * If 'ns' is NULL, then lockh describes an existing lock that we want to look
1316  * for a duplicate of.
1317  *
1318  * Otherwise, all of the fields must be filled in, to match against.
1319  *
1320  * If 'flags' contains LDLM_FL_LOCAL_ONLY, then only match local locks on the
1321  *     server (ie, connh is NULL)
1322  * If 'flags' contains LDLM_FL_BLOCK_GRANTED, then only locks on the granted
1323  *     list will be considered
1324  * If 'flags' contains LDLM_FL_CBPENDING, then locks that have been marked
1325  *     to be canceled can still be matched as long as they still have reader
1326  *     or writer refernces
1327  * If 'flags' contains L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K, then don't actually reference a lock,
1328  *     just tell us if we would have matched.
1329  *
1330  * \retval 1 if it finds an already-existing lock that is compatible; in this
1331  * case, lockh is filled in with a addref()ed lock
1332  *
1333  * We also check security context, and if that fails we simply return 0 (to
1334  * keep caller code unchanged), the context failure will be discovered by
1335  * caller sometime later.
1336  */
1337 ldlm_mode_t ldlm_lock_match(struct ldlm_namespace *ns, __u64 flags,
1338                             const struct ldlm_res_id *res_id, ldlm_type_t type,
1339                             ldlm_policy_data_t *policy, ldlm_mode_t mode,
1340                             struct lustre_handle *lockh, int unref)
1341 {
1342         struct ldlm_resource *res;
1343         struct ldlm_lock *lock, *old_lock = NULL;
1344         int rc = 0;
1345         ENTRY;
1346
1347         if (ns == NULL) {
1348                 old_lock = ldlm_handle2lock(lockh);
1349                 LASSERT(old_lock);
1350
1351                 ns = ldlm_lock_to_ns(old_lock);
1352                 res_id = &old_lock->l_resource->lr_name;
1353                 type = old_lock->l_resource->lr_type;
1354                 mode = old_lock->l_req_mode;
1355         }
1356
1357         res = ldlm_resource_get(ns, NULL, res_id, type, 0);
1358         if (res == NULL) {
1359                 LASSERT(old_lock == NULL);
1360                 RETURN(0);
1361         }
1362
1363         LDLM_RESOURCE_ADDREF(res);
1364         lock_res(res);
1365
1366         lock = search_queue(&res->lr_granted, &mode, policy, old_lock,
1367                             flags, unref);
1368         if (lock != NULL)
1369                 GOTO(out, rc = 1);
1370         if (flags & LDLM_FL_BLOCK_GRANTED)
1371                 GOTO(out, rc = 0);
1372         lock = search_queue(&res->lr_converting, &mode, policy, old_lock,
1373                             flags, unref);
1374         if (lock != NULL)
1375                 GOTO(out, rc = 1);
1376         lock = search_queue(&res->lr_waiting, &mode, policy, old_lock,
1377                             flags, unref);
1378         if (lock != NULL)
1379                 GOTO(out, rc = 1);
1380
1381         EXIT;
1382  out:
1383         unlock_res(res);
1384         LDLM_RESOURCE_DELREF(res);
1385         ldlm_resource_putref(res);
1386
1387         if (lock) {
1388                 ldlm_lock2handle(lock, lockh);
1389                 if ((flags & LDLM_FL_LVB_READY) &&
1390                     (!ldlm_is_lvb_ready(lock))) {
1391                         __u64 wait_flags = LDLM_FL_LVB_READY |
1392                                 LDLM_FL_DESTROYED | LDLM_FL_FAIL_NOTIFIED;
1393                         struct l_wait_info lwi;
1394                         if (lock->l_completion_ast) {
1395                                 int err = lock->l_completion_ast(lock,
1396                                                           LDLM_FL_WAIT_NOREPROC,
1397                                                                  NULL);
1398                                 if (err) {
1399                                         if (flags & L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K)
1400                                                 LDLM_LOCK_RELEASE(lock);
1401                                         else
1402                                                 ldlm_lock_decref_internal(lock,
1403                                                                           mode);
1404                                         rc = 0;
1405                                         goto out2;
1406                                 }
1407                         }
1408
1409                         lwi = LWI_TIMEOUT_INTR(cfs_time_seconds(obd_timeout),
1410                                                NULL, LWI_ON_SIGNAL_NOOP, NULL);
1411
1412                         /* XXX FIXME see comment on CAN_MATCH in lustre_dlm.h */
1413                         l_wait_event(lock->l_waitq,
1414                                      lock->l_flags & wait_flags,
1415                                      &lwi);
1416                         if (!ldlm_is_lvb_ready(lock)) {
1417                                 if (flags & L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K)
1418                                         LDLM_LOCK_RELEASE(lock);
1419                                 else
1420                                         ldlm_lock_decref_internal(lock, mode);
1421                                 rc = 0;
1422                         }
1423                 }
1424         }
1425  out2:
1426         if (rc) {
1427                 LDLM_DEBUG(lock, "matched ("LPU64" "LPU64")",
1428                            (type == LDLM_PLAIN || type == LDLM_IBITS) ?
1429                                 res_id->name[2] : policy->l_extent.start,
1430                            (type == LDLM_PLAIN || type == LDLM_IBITS) ?
1431                                 res_id->name[3] : policy->l_extent.end);
1432
1433                 /* check user's security context */
1434                 if (lock->l_conn_export &&
1435                     sptlrpc_import_check_ctx(
1436                                 class_exp2cliimp(lock->l_conn_export))) {
1437                         if (!(flags & L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K))
1438                                 ldlm_lock_decref_internal(lock, mode);
1439                         rc = 0;
1440                 }
1441
1442                 if (flags & L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K)
1443                         LDLM_LOCK_RELEASE(lock);
1444
1445         } else if (!(flags & L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K)) {/*less verbose for test-only*/
1446                 LDLM_DEBUG_NOLOCK("not matched ns %p type %u mode %u res "
1447                                   LPU64"/"LPU64" ("LPU64" "LPU64")", ns,
1448                                   type, mode, res_id->name[0], res_id->name[1],
1449                                   (type == LDLM_PLAIN || type == LDLM_IBITS) ?
1450                                         res_id->name[2] :policy->l_extent.start,
1451                                   (type == LDLM_PLAIN || type == LDLM_IBITS) ?
1452                                         res_id->name[3] : policy->l_extent.end);
1453         }
1454         if (old_lock)
1455                 LDLM_LOCK_PUT(old_lock);
1456
1457         return rc ? mode : 0;
1458 }
1459 EXPORT_SYMBOL(ldlm_lock_match);

1654 }
1655
1656 /**
1657  * Enqueue (request) a lock.
1658  *
1659  * Does not block. As a result of enqueue the lock would be put
1660  * into granted or waiting list.
1661  *
1662  * If namespace has intent policy sent and the lock has LDLM_FL_HAS_INTENT flag
1663  * set, skip all the enqueueing and delegate lock processing to intent policy
1664  * function.
1665  */
1666 ldlm_error_t ldlm_lock_enqueue(struct ldlm_namespace *ns,
1667                                struct ldlm_lock **lockp,
1668                                void *cookie, __u64 *flags)
1669 {
1670         struct ldlm_lock *lock = *lockp;
1671         struct ldlm_resource *res = lock->l_resource;
1672         int local = ns_is_client(ldlm_res_to_ns(res));
1673 #ifdef HAVE_SERVER_SUPPORT
1674         ldlm_processing_policy policy;
1675 #endif
1676         ldlm_error_t rc = ELDLM_OK;
1677         struct ldlm_interval *node = NULL;
1678         ENTRY;
1679
1680         lock->l_last_activity = cfs_time_current_sec();
1681         /* policies are not executed on the client or during replay */
1682         if ((*flags & (LDLM_FL_HAS_INTENT|LDLM_FL_REPLAY)) == LDLM_FL_HAS_INTENT
1683             && !local && ns->ns_policy) {
1684                 rc = ns->ns_policy(ns, lockp, cookie, lock->l_req_mode, *flags,
1685                                    NULL);
1686                 if (rc == ELDLM_LOCK_REPLACED) {
1687                         /* The lock that was returned has already been granted,
1688                          * and placed into lockp.  If it's not the same as the
1689                          * one we passed in, then destroy the old one and our
1690                          * work here is done. */
1691                         if (lock != *lockp) {
1692                                 ldlm_lock_destroy(lock);
1693                                 LDLM_LOCK_RELEASE(lock);
1694                         }
1695                         *flags |= LDLM_FL_LOCK_CHANGED;
1696                         RETURN(0);
1697                 } else if (rc != ELDLM_OK ||
1698                            (rc == ELDLM_OK && (*flags & LDLM_FL_INTENT_ONLY))) {
1699                         ldlm_lock_destroy(lock);
1700                         RETURN(rc);
1701                 }
1702         }
1703
1704         /* For a replaying lock, it might be already in granted list. So
1705          * unlinking the lock will cause the interval node to be freed, we
1706          * have to allocate the interval node early otherwise we can't regrant
1707          * this lock in the future. - jay */
1708         if (!local && (*flags & LDLM_FL_REPLAY) && res->lr_type == LDLM_EXTENT)
1709                 OBD_SLAB_ALLOC_PTR_GFP(node, ldlm_interval_slab, GFP_NOFS);
1710
1711         lock_res_and_lock(lock);
1712         if (local && lock->l_req_mode == lock->l_granted_mode) {
1713                 /* The server returned a blocked lock, but it was granted
1714                  * before we got a chance to actually enqueue it.  We don't
1715                  * need to do anything else. */
1716                 *flags &= ~(LDLM_FL_BLOCK_GRANTED |
1717                             LDLM_FL_BLOCK_CONV | LDLM_FL_BLOCK_WAIT);
1718                 GOTO(out, rc = ELDLM_OK);
1719         }
1720
1721         ldlm_resource_unlink_lock(lock);
1722         if (res->lr_type == LDLM_EXTENT && lock->l_tree_node == NULL) {
1723                 if (node == NULL) {
1724                         ldlm_lock_destroy_nolock(lock);
1725                         GOTO(out, rc = -ENOMEM);
1726                 }
1727
1728                 CFS_INIT_LIST_HEAD(&node->li_group);
1729                 ldlm_interval_attach(node, lock);
1730                 node = NULL;
1731         }
1732
1733         /* Some flags from the enqueue want to make it into the AST, via the
1734          * lock's l_flags. */
1735         if (*flags & LDLM_FL_AST_DISCARD_DATA)
1736                 ldlm_set_ast_discard_data(lock);
1737         if (*flags & LDLM_FL_TEST_LOCK)
1738                 ldlm_set_test_lock(lock);
1739
1740         /* This distinction between local lock trees is very important; a client
1741          * namespace only has information about locks taken by that client, and
1742          * thus doesn't have enough information to decide for itself if it can
1743          * be granted (below).  In this case, we do exactly what the server
1744          * tells us to do, as dictated by the 'flags'.
1745          *
1746          * We do exactly the same thing during recovery, when the server is
1747          * more or less trusting the clients not to lie.
1748          *
1749          * FIXME (bug 268): Detect obvious lies by checking compatibility in
1750          * granted/converting queues. */
1751         if (local) {
1752                 if (*flags & LDLM_FL_BLOCK_CONV)
1753                         ldlm_resource_add_lock(res, &res->lr_converting, lock);
1754                 else if (*flags & (LDLM_FL_BLOCK_WAIT | LDLM_FL_BLOCK_GRANTED))
1755                         ldlm_resource_add_lock(res, &res->lr_waiting, lock);
1756                 else
1757                         ldlm_grant_lock(lock, NULL);
1758                 GOTO(out, rc = ELDLM_OK);
1759 #ifdef HAVE_SERVER_SUPPORT
1760         } else if (*flags & LDLM_FL_REPLAY) {
1761                 if (*flags & LDLM_FL_BLOCK_CONV) {
1762                         ldlm_resource_add_lock(res, &res->lr_converting, lock);
1763                         GOTO(out, rc = ELDLM_OK);
1764                 } else if (*flags & LDLM_FL_BLOCK_WAIT) {
1765                         ldlm_resource_add_lock(res, &res->lr_waiting, lock);
1766                         GOTO(out, rc = ELDLM_OK);
1767                 } else if (*flags & LDLM_FL_BLOCK_GRANTED) {
1768                         ldlm_grant_lock(lock, NULL);
1769                         GOTO(out, rc = ELDLM_OK);
1770                 }
1771                 /* If no flags, fall through to normal enqueue path. */
1772         }
1773
1774         policy = ldlm_processing_policy_table[res->lr_type];
1775         policy(lock, flags, 1, &rc, NULL);
1776         GOTO(out, rc);
1777 #else
1778         } else {
1779                 CERROR("This is client-side-only module, cannot handle "
1780                        "LDLM_NAMESPACE_SERVER resource type lock.\n");
1781                 LBUG();
1782         }
1783 #endif
1784
1785 out:
1786         unlock_res_and_lock(lock);
1787         if (node)
1788                 OBD_SLAB_FREE(node, ldlm_interval_slab, sizeof(*node));
1789         return rc;
1790 }
